Kukretha
Kukretha is a village located in Isagarh tehsil of Ashoknagar district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 24km away from sub-district headquarter Isagarh (tehsildar office) and 25km away from district headquarter Ashoknagar. As per 2009 stats, Kuraila is the gram panchayat of Kukretha village.

About Kukretha
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kukretha is 500009. The village spans a total geographical area of 313 hectares. Isagarh is nearest town to Kukretha village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 24km away.
When it comes to local governance, Kukretha village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Chanderi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Guna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Kukretha
According to the 2011 Census, Kukretha has a total population of about 357, with approximately 186 males and 171 females. The sex ratio is around 919 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 35 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 92 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 85.15%, with male literacy at about 89.25% and female literacy near 80.70%. There are around 65 households in the village. Connectivity of Kukretha
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kukretha. As per the 2011 stats, Kukretha had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
